the Pacific Disability Forum
We are a constituency of 71 organisations of/for persons with disabilities and individual members representing diverse groups of persons with disabilities and their supporters in 22 Pacific Island countries and territories.

A partnership of regional organisation of and for persons with disabilities and representing their voice for inclusion in compliance with the United Nations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ities (CRPD).
To ensure full inclusion and effective participation of persons with disabilities in the Pacific Island countries and territories through:
- our evidence-based advocacy and
- active engagement in policy development,
- implementation and monitoring of the CRPD, SDG, PFRPD, Incheon
- Strategy and other relevant global and regional frameworks, in collaboration with relevant stakeholders.

The Pacific Disability Forum (PDF) is a regional non-governmental organisation established in December 2002 and formally inaugurated in July 2004. At the inaugural PDF meeting in Fiji in 2004, members again earnestly discuss the possibility of making PDF a formal organisation and establishing a regional office plan, which was presented at its annual general meeting at the end of 2004.
